About Naturally Iowa, Inc.
Naturally Iowa, Inc. (www.naturallyiowa.com), operating through its wholly owned subsidiary, Naturally Iowa, LLC, distributes Green Bottle(TM) Spring Water brand bottled water, and manufactures and distributes organic and all-natural dairy products. The Company's main dairy product lines are organic and all-natural fluid milk, ice cream and drinkable yogurt. In 2003, Naturally Iowa, LLC developed a working partnership with NatureWorks, LLC, and became the world's first dairy to use NatureWorks® environmentally friendly Ingeo(TM) bottling. Naturally Iowa, Inc. operates its state-of-the-art, 28,500-sq.-foot dairy processing facility in Clarinda, Iowa.
About Grand Springs Natural Spring Water
Grand Springs Natural Spring Water (www.grandsprings.com) is an award-winning bottler of natural spring water. Located in the fertile hills east of the Shenandoah Mountains in Alton, Virginia, Grand Springs draws its pure, delicious water from natural springs deep beneath certified organic fields. These springs were enjoyed by Native Americans for hundreds of years, and provided refreshment to Colonial American passengers on the coach between Lynchburg, Virginia and Fayetteville, North Carolina. The modern FDA-approved bottling facilities at Grand Springs provide the delicious water of the springs in several single-serve bottle sizes as well as larger carafes for offices and home water systems. Grand Springs is the official bottler for Naturally Iowa, Inc. for the eastern region of the country.
